Pros

The work environment at UPS is amazing, filled with friendly and helpful colleagues. This job role is easy to learn and will improve your customer service skills. Overtime pay is good too.

Cons

Driver helpers cannot work during the weekend which can be difficult for people who are busy from Monday to Friday, such as students, Also, the coordinator may send you to work where the commute is long, however if it is obnoxiously far, you can discuss it with the coordinator and change it.

Pros

Good money. Easy but can be physical

Cons

Hours are either like 3 hours a day or 8 hours a day and you have no clue which one until you meet your driver for the day
